Team News

Arsenal will be without defenders Calafiori, Gabriel Magalhães, and Tomiyasu. Kai Havertz and Gabriel Jesus are out for the season, and Raheem Sterling is banned for this tie.

Bukayo Saka is back for the Gunners and might be unleashed fully today against Real Madrid. Mikel Merino should also be available, despite suffering a cut to the head during the weekend.

Real Madrid will be without Aurélien Tchouaméni, as he is banned due to accumulation of yellow cards. Madrid will also be without Ceballos, Carvajal, Militão, Mendy, and Lunin for this tie.

Stats

  • Real Madrid have played against Arsenal twice and have failed to score.
  • Arsenal have an 80% win rate in their last Champions League home matches.
  • Real Madrid haven’t lost the first leg in any of their last eight knockout-stage ties in the UEFA Champions League (W5 D3).
  • Real Madrid have won 3 out of their 6 away games this season in the Champions League.
  • Real Madrid have played 22 matches against English sides since 2017/18 in the knockout stages of the UEFA Champions League (W11 D5 L6).

Analysis

Arsenal are a very strong side defensively, and Real Madrid will have a tough time breaking them down. The Gunners can also be very dangerous with set pieces. Valencia showed how vulnerable Los Blancos can be when defending set pieces — the Gunners can try to capitalize on that against Real Madrid.

Real Madrid are a different side in the Champions League, and they’ve shown that many times over the years. It will be tough to break down an Arsenal side, but with an attack of Bellingham, Mbappé, Vinícius, and Rodrygo, they can easily blow a depleted Arsenal defense away on their day.
